Description
Viewing is essential of this detached house that offers potential to be extended and altered subject to any necessary consent. The current accommodation is arranged around a large reception hall and throughout the house retains the original period joinery. The principal reception room extends across the rear of the house and opens to the level gardens. There is a separate study/dining room with a conservatory and kitchen to the ground floor whilst to the first floor are three bedrooms, one which offers access to the attic which is considered to offer potential for further conversion. Situated in a desirable location fronting Whatlington Road, the property enjoys a large area of enclosed level garden and ample parking all set within a convenient location just a short distance from the historic High Street and mainline station.
